Ingredients
- 1¼ cups (300 ml) 100% orange juice
- 1 cup plain, vanilla, or coconut Greek yogurt
- ½ cup chia seeds
- 1 cup fresh strawberries, hulled and chopped or lightly mashed
- 1 tablespoon maple syrup or honey (optional)
- ½ teaspoon vanilla extract (optional)
Instructions
Step 1: Prepare the Strawberries
Place the chopped strawberries into a large mixing bowl or storage container. Lightly mash them with a fork to release some of their natural juices while leaving small fruit pieces for texture.
Step 2: Mix the Base
Add the orange juice, Greek yogurt, vanilla extract, and maple syrup or honey if using.
Whisk until the mixture becomes smooth and well combined.
Step 3: Add the Chia Seeds
Stir in the chia seeds thoroughly, making sure they are evenly distributed throughout the mixture.
Allow the mixture to rest for 5 to 10 minutes, then stir again to prevent the chia seeds from settling or clumping together.
The magic happens while the pudding chills—overnight, the chia seeds absorb the liquid and transform into a thick, creamy texture that’s perfect for breakfast or dessert.
